Camilla Dallerup has blasted 'Strictly Come Dancing' judges for making the show too serious.

The blonde beauty - who is partnering 'Holby City' star Tom Chambers in this year's series - hit out at Len Goodman, Arlene Phillips, Bruno Tonioli and Craig Revel Horwood for "taking all the fun" out of the programme after their constant criticism of John Sergeant led to him quitting the BBC1 show.

Professional dancer Camilla, 34, said: "We have to remember 'Strictly Come Dancing' is an entertainment programme. The public don't like being bossed around and told what to do.

"I'm sure there are a lot of people at home who sit around and argue about who to vote for. Many voted for John because he was entertaining - not because he was a good dancer. That's their choice and that's fine with me."

John quit the show last month following increasing anger from the judges that he had remained on the show despite being regarded as one of the worst celebrity dancers still in the competition.
